DOCUMENTATION EN LIGNE
DE WINDEVWEBDEV ET WINDEV MOBILE

Version : 2025

Visibilité des éléments d'un composant externe
Lors de la création d'un composant externe, il est possible de définir les éléments du composant externe qui seront accessibles ou non par l'utilisateur du composant...
Composant externe WINDEV, WEBDEV, Android et iOS
Un composant externe est un ensemble d'éléments WINDEV, WEBDEV ou WINDEV Mobile ...
Déploiement d'une application utilisant un composant externe
Le déploiement d'une application utilisant un ou plusieurs composants externes se fait de la même façon que le déploiement d'une application classique ...
Utiliser un composant externe dans une application
Un composant peut être réutilisé à tout moment dans n'importe quelle application ...
Modifier un composant externe
A tout moment, un composant externe créé et généré avec WINDEV, WEBDEV ou WINDEV Mobile peut être modifié...
Distribuer un composant externe
Lorsque le composant externe a été créé, testé et généré, il peut être mis à disposition des développeurs...
Créer et générer un composant externe
La création d'un composant externe doit être effectuée à partir d'un projet contenant tous les éléments nécessaires au fonctionnement du composant...
Documentation automatique des composants externes
Un composant externe doit absolument être accompagné d'une documentation pour permettre son utilisation...
Composants externes multi-produits
La notion de composant fait le bonheur de toutes les équipes de développement qui les ont adoptés...
Fichier "Composant.WDO"
Lors de la génération du composant externe, deux fichiers sont automatiquement créés dans le répertoire EXE du projet en cours ...
nWDExecute : Exécution d'une fonction du WLangage
Exécution d'une fonction du WLangage par compilation dynamique avec formatage de commande......
nWDExecuteEx : Exécution d'une fonction du WLangage
Exécution d'une fonction du WLangage par compilation dynamique sans formatage de commande......
nWDGetHFContext : Récupération du contexte HFSQL
Récupération du contexte HFSQL (en C, Pascal et Visual Basic uniquement)......
nWDGetLastError : Code d'erreur de la dernière erreur
Code d'erreur de la dernière erreur......
nWDInitProjet : Code d'initialisation du projet
Exécution du code d'initialisation du projet......
nWDSetCallbackNext
Renseignement de la "callback" appelée lors de l'utilisation des mots-clé WDTOUCHE et RENVOIEWDTOUCHE pour la prochaine fenêtre à ouvrir (en C, Pascal et Visual Basic uniquement)......
pszWDGetLastError : Message de la dernière erreur
Récupération du message correspondant à la dernière erreur survenue......
WDRepriseErreur : Reprise sur erreur
Cette fonction force la reprise normale de l'exécution après une erreur......
wWDGetTypeValeurRetour
Type de la valeur de retour de la dernière instruction nWDExecute, nWDExecuteEx, ou nWDEvalue......
Achats In-App
Les systèmes mobiles (Android/iOS) permettent à leurs applications de proposer du contenu payant, en utilisant le système de paiement de l'App Store ou de Google Play......
3. Le modèle UML en pratique
Collage spécial
La commande Collage Spécial permet de choisir explicitement le format sous lequel le contenu du presse-papiers doit être collé dans l'éditeur de fenêtres......
HsMenu,Libelle (Fonction)
Modifie le libellé d'une option de menu....
Le champ Tableau de bord
Les tableaux de bord logiciels sont des éléments importants d'une application ......
Champ épinglé dans une fenêtre
Un champ épinglé est un champ qui reste visible même si l'utilisateur déplace l'ascenseur de son conteneur pour afficher la zone non visible du conteneur......
Le gestionnaire de sources
WINDEV, WEBDEV et WINDEV Mobile proposent un gestionnaire de sources très élaboré......
Instanciation d'un objet
Pour accéder à une classe, il faut déclarer l'objet comme étant de la classe à manipuler, on parle d'instanciation d'un objet......
Volet "Exemples unitaires"
Le volet "Exemples unitaires" propose les exemples unitaires disponibles selon les différents produits......
Modèle de champs
Un modèle de champs est un ensemble de champs, réutilisables dans plusieurs fenêtres ou pages......
fRépertoireExiste (Fonction)
Teste l'existence d'un répertoire....
Impression de la documentation technique
Il est possible d'imprimer différentes documentations techniques détaillant l'ensemble des éléments (fenêtre, page, état, fichier de données, rubrique, composant, assemblage, perso-dossiers, ......
Mécanisme des exceptions générales
Un traitement d'exception général est disponible pour l'ensemble des composants de l'objet auquel il est associé......
Déploiement ad Hoc
Jointures entre les fichiers de données d'une requête de sélection
Lorsque plusieurs fichiers de données sont utilisés dans une requête, l'éditeur de requêtes recherche automatiquement les liaisons décrites dans l'analyse entre ces fichiers de données......
Les différents types de parcours disponibles en SQL
Pour parcourir le résultat d'une requête exécutée avec la fonction SQLExec, deux types de parcours sont disponibles ......